#f6b435 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f6b435 is composed of 96.5% red, 70.6%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.8% magenta, 78.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 39.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 58.6%. #f6b435 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6a with #ed6900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f6b435 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f6b435 has RGB values of R:246, G:180,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.78,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16167989.

Shades and Tints of #f6b435
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050300 is the darkest color, while #fefaf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6b435
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d988e is the less saturated color, while #feb72d is the most saturated one.
